There was a problem hiding this comment.
Importing katex/dist/katex.min.css here makes KaTeX styles unlayered and globally applied, which also prevents the layered overrides in styles/markdown.css from taking effect (unlayered styles outrank layered ones). Consider moving the KaTeX CSS import into styles/markdown.css using a named layer and declaring layer order, so KaTeX base styles and your overrides compose predictably.

There was a problem hiding this comment.
The $...$ inline math tokenizer currently refuses to open when the character after $ is whitespace (canOpenInlineMath), which means inputs like $ \mathbb{R}$ / $ FORMULA $ won’t be recognized even though normalizeMathContent() trims whitespace (and the issue/PR description explicitly calls out this format). Consider allowing optional leading/trailing spaces inside the delimiters and rely on trimming + additional heuristics (e.g., avoid parsing when adjacent to digits/word chars) to reduce currency false-positives instead of hard-rejecting whitespace.

There was a problem hiding this comment.
These KaTeX overrides are inside @layer components, but KaTeX’s own stylesheet is imported unlayered (from components/markdown.tsx). In the cascade-layer model, unlayered styles outrank layered ones regardless of selector specificity, so KaTeX’s base .katex / .katex-display declarations will override these adjustments. To ensure these rules apply, either move them out of a layer, or import KaTeX CSS into a named layer and order layers so components comes after it.

There was a problem hiding this comment.
renderMathToken falls back to escapeHtml(content) on empty/invalid formulas, but content is the inner math text (without $...$ / \(...\) delimiters). That makes failures less obvious and changes what the user typed. Consider falling back to the original raw token (including delimiters) or wrapping the fallback in a consistent error element so users can still see the exact input.
